在列车车底数量有限的条件下,利用多商品网络流模型对列车车底的套用问题建立数学优化模型,对车底套用方案进行优化,即把列车运行图转化为网络图,而后根据流守恒、容量限制和维修等约束条件,建立以列车运输能力最大化为目标的整数规划模型。
